I have had my T2 for about two weeks now and am making slow but reasonable progress with the programing. My system is fairly complex, my Meridian equipment has many remote functions that I have put on seperate pages for ease of use. My house is small and so far problems I thought were related to rf reception were in fact program issues (one little hint: put a mirror to reflect the red light on the IRQ6 so you can see if the signal is getting through). Another thing that has thrown a wrench in my programing is the number of "repeats" and when to sustain the signal or not. I now think that learning commands can introduce extra "repeats" that will cause no response or a repeated response (a change of four or five channels at a push of the button). This can eat up a lot of time as you have to make the change, download it and try it. On your last issue I hope the small database is due to fewer problems with the unit. I had two ProntoPro 6000 frezze up on me and my dealer took all the P.P. stuff back in exchange for the T2. It is much easier to setup and program and I'll stick with it.
